What is LivePlan and why nigerian entrepreneurs use it

LivePlan is a cloud-based business planning platform that helps you build financial forecasts, create structured business plans, and track performance dashboards from anywhere with an internet connection. Many Nigerian business owners, accountants, and startup founders turn to LivePlan to simplify financial modelling and produce professional pitch documents without hiring expensive consultants.

The service runs entirely online, integrates with accounting tools like Xero and QuickBooks, and offers AI-powered guidance to speed up plan creation. You subscribe monthly or annually in US dollars (USD), which means your costs fluctuate with the naira exchange rate-something important to track when budgeting your subscription renewal.

Who relies on LivePlan

Small business owners and startup founders across Nigeria use LivePlan to present credible financial projections to banks, investors, and partners. Accountants and business advisors recommend it to clients because it automates financial statement generation and scenario modelling. If you're bootstrapping a new venture or seeking funding, LivePlan appeals because it eliminates the need for expensive financial software licenses.

The catch with global subscriptions

Because LivePlan operates from the United States and bills in USD, you face currency exchange risk and limited local customer support channels. This becomes critical when cancellation time arrives-you need to know your rights under Nigerian law and understand what happens to your data and money.

After cancellation, your access continues until the end of the current paid period, and you will not be billed again.

LivePlan offers a 35-day money-back guarantee for direct subscriptions, but cancellation alone does not trigger a refund.

If you subscribed through the Apple App Store or Google Play, you must cancel through those platforms' subscription management systems.

It is recommended to export or back up your plans and financials before cancellation, as LivePlan does not guarantee data retention after your paid period ends.
